悠悠楠杉
易支付API接口:高效、安全、灵活的支付解决方案
一、易支付API接口的特点
1. 高效性
易支付API接口采用先进的加密技术和高性能的服务器架构,确保交易处理速度快、效率高。无论是日常的交易处理还是高峰期的并发请求,都能保持稳定的性能表现。
2. 安全性
安全性是易支付API接口的核心竞争力之一。它采用国际标准的SSL加密技术,对所有传输的数据进行加密处理,确保数据在传输过程中的安全。同时,易支付还具备防篡改、防重放等安全机制,有效防止支付过程中的欺诈行为。
3. 灵活性
易支付API接口支持多种支付方式,包括但不限于银行卡支付、第三方支付(如微信、支付宝)、电子钱包等。同时,其开放的API接口设计使得开发者可以轻松地将其集成到自己的系统中,实现定制化的支付解决方案。
4. 可扩展性
随着业务的发展和需求的变化,易支付API接口提供丰富的接口和灵活的配置选项,使得企业可以轻松地根据需要进行扩展和调整,以适应不断变化的市场环境。
二、易支付API接口的功能
1. 交易处理
- 创建交易:提供创建新交易的功能,包括设置交易金额、交易类型等。
- 查询交易状态:可以实时查询交易的状态,如待确认、已成功、已失败等。
- 撤销交易:在特定条件下,提供撤销已创建但未完成的交易的功能。
2. 用户管理
- 用户注册与登录:支持用户通过API进行注册和登录操作。
- 用户信息管理:提供查询和更新用户信息的功能,如修改密码、更新联系方式等。
3. 退款与清算
- 退款处理:支持对已完成的交易进行退款操作。
- 清算报告:提供每日的交易清算报告,帮助企业了解当天的交易情况。
1. 场景一:在线商城支付集成
场景描述:
在一个在线商城中,用户选择商品后进入结算页面,通过调用易支付API接口完成支付操作。
示例代码(创建交易):
plaintext
POST /api/v1/transactions HTTP/1.1
Host: example.easypayment.com
Authorization: Basic QWxhZ...= # Base64编码的用户名和密码
Content-Type: application/json
Accept: application/json
json
{
"amount": 1000, // 交易金额(单位:分)
"currency": "CNY", // 货币类型(此处为人民币)
"type": "purchase", // 交易类型(购买)
"orderId": "123456789", // 订单ID(用于唯一标识一笔交易)
"description": "购买商品A" // 交易描述信息(可选)
}
响应示例:
plaintext
HTTP/1.1 200 OK
Content-Type: application/json; charset=utf-8
json
{
"id": "0987654321", // 交易ID(用于查询交易状态)
"status": "pending", // 交易状态(待确认)
"message": "Transaction created successfully." // 响应消息(成功创建交易)
}